Hendrix takes out Sewanee, 2-1

SEWANEE, Tenn. - The Warriors defeated Sewanee (Tenn.), 2-1, on Friday in Southern Athletic Association (SAA) action, ending a four-game losing streak in the series while picking up their first win at Puett Field since 2015.

Hendrix (3-6-2, 2-2-1 SAA) moved into a tie with Centre (Ky.) for third place in the league standings. The Warriors face the Colonels on Sunday at 1:30 p.m. CT in the second of three-straight road games to end conference play.

Will Kelton (3) scored his third goal in four games in the 27th minute Friday with an assist by Zack Roberts. 

Following a 48-minute lightning delay during halftime, Jake Nelson (2) scored what proved to be the game-winner at the 57:08 mark. Severin Velasco (5) converted a penalty kick 23 seconds later, but James Leone (3-5-1) was forced to only make one save the rest of the match, coming with 21 seconds to play, to preserve Matt Kern's first victory in five tries against his former squad.

"I am really happy for our group to come away with three points against a good Sewanee team in very difficult conditions," Kern said. "The first half I thought we were the better team and deserved the 1-0 lead. In the second half, Sewanee outplayed us, and the game was in the balance until the final whistle. I am proud of Will and Jake for each getting a goal, Zack for organizing the central defenders and James for playing well in goal."

Kristian Reed ended with three shots in the win. Kelton and Nelson each had two shots. Both of Kelton's were on frame. Reed and Nelson each had one shot on goal.

Leone totaled two saves in 90 minutes between the pipes.

The Warriors held an edge in corner kicks, 4-3.

Evan Poole had four shots for Sewanee (6-6-1, 2-3 SAA), which saw its two-game win streak come to an end.

J.P. Furman (6-6-1) made two saves in 90 minutes in net in defeat.
